In a world where secrets kill, an ex-cop discovers heβs got the biggest secret of all.β¦ Set in a 21st-century Ottoman Empire, Jon Courtenay Grimwoodβs acclaimed Arabesk series is a noir action- thriller with an exotic twist. Here an ex-cop with nothing to lose finds himself on the trail of a man he doesnβt believe in: his father. Ashraf Bey has been a lot of thingsβand most of them illegal. Now, having resigned as El Iskandryiaβs Chief of Detectives, heβs taking stock of his life and thereβs not much: a mistress heβs never made love to, a niece everyone thinks is mentally incompetent, and a credit card bill rising towards infinity. With a revolt breaking out across North Africa, the world seems to be racing Raf straight to hell. The last thing he needs is a father heβs never known. But when the old Emirβs security chief requests that Raf come out of retirement to investigate an assassination attempt on His Excellency, thatβs exactly what Raf gets. Now, disguised as an itinerant laborer, Raf goes underground to discover a manβand a pastβhe never knewβ¦and wonβt survive again.
